The REHVA HVAC World Congress CLIMA is the leading international scientific congress in the field of he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C). After the great success of the 2025 edition, organized by AiCARR, the baton now passes to for the organization of CLIMA 2028: the 16th REHVA HVAC World Congress, which will be held in Espoo, Finland from June 11th to 14th, 2028. The theme of this Finnish edition is “Zero-Emission and Energy Flexible Buildings for a Sustainable Built Environment”, a topic that highlights the fundamental importance of the HVAC sector in all its aspects. In this perspective, CLIMA 2028 will offer professionals, academics, and companies in the HVAC sector a unique opportunity for international discussion about these “hot” topics. It brings together professionals and researchers to share the latest scientific knowledge, discuss current challenges in the field, and find solutions – all aiming for a more sustainable, healthier, and energy-efficient built environment.

This event is organized by REHVA and one of its members, and it takes place once every three years. In 2028, REHVA will be partnering with Aalto University Finland and Finnish Society of Indoor Air Quality and Climate to co-organize the event.
